People are talking, talking about vehicle fraud

Once again, the issue of vehicle fraud crimes is hitting the news.  This time in Baltimore, Md.

In today's Baltimore Examiner, reporter Carolyn Peirce digs into the consumer and homeland security issues associated with vehicle fraud crimes like VIN Cloning, odometer rollbacks and vehicle title washing.  

Peirce clearly illustrates, through in depth interviews, with people like Greg Terp of the Miami Dade Police Department and Frank Scafidi from the National Insurance Crime Bureau just how these crimes occur.  But perhaps more importantly, in a separate piece, she also articulates the need for the solution to these crimes:  NMVTIS.

But what is disheartening is that she also interviewed the press secretary in Sen. Mikulski's (D-MD) office and learned there are no federal funds from the Commerce Justice and Science Appropriations Subcommittee in this fiscal year to support this federally-mandated system that studies say have benefits in the billions.

Maybe next year.
